Congratulations to these Biscuit Book Hotshot, Author Specialists, and this Henry and Mudge Expert. To be a Biscuit Book Hotshot students need to read all 19 Biscuit books and pass the quizzes! To be a Henry and Mudge Expert students need to read all 32 Henry and Mudge books and pass the quizzes. To be an Author Specialists students need to read 25 Margaret Hillert books and passed all the quizzes. Way to go readers! 📚 #WeLoveReading #WhatAreYouReadingWednesday #WalworthProud #WalworthJ1

During the month of February, we celebrated "Diversity" in Guidance class. Students in JK-4th grade boarded a plane and traveled to Hungary, Brazil, Iceland, Thailand, and Mexico. Through the use of technology and "good old fashioned imagination," our adventures were fantastic! From climbing a pyramid in Chichen Itza to swimming in the Blue Lagoon and taking a helicopter ride for great aerial views of geysers, our adventures were priceless! Our country visits also included the students either being able to try native food from that country or making a project. Our goal is for students to understand themselves and appreciate the diverse backgrounds and experiences of others. Spread acceptance, tolerance and kindness! #WalworthJ1

Mrs. Hummel's kindergarten had so much fun celebrating Dr. Seuss's birthday! They had a great time dressing up for Wacky Wednesday, with backwards clothes, mis-matched shoes and socks, and crazy hair! The class made green eggs and ham, and each student got to crack his/her own egg! Of course the children asked, Mr. KLAMM, do you like green eggs and HAM?" Yes, he did! Mr. Beauchaine was a special guest reader of Green Eggs and Ham, and he didn't like our green eggs and ham, he LOVED them! Everyone had fun dressing up with our special Dr. Seuss props and costumes! If was a wonderful week of rhyming and fun with Dr. Seuss stories, cartoons, art projects, and creativity! ❤📚❤ #DrSeuss #WeLoveReading #WalworthJ1
